We’re a fast-growing, private equity-backed education company on a mission to transform learning outcomes at scale. With ambitious growth plans and a commitment to excellence, we’re building a world-class team to shape the future of education. We’re looking for a strategic and hands-on Head of Talent to lead our end-to-end Talent strategy, reporting directly to the COO. This is a critical leadership role responsible for attracting, developing, and retaining top talent across the business—while building a culture of high performance, continuous learning, and inclusion.

More about the role:

  • Continuous improvement and execution of a scalable talent acquisition strategy aligned with business growth.
  • Building a strong employer brand and candidate experience.
  • Partner with leaders to forecast and fulfill talent needs across all functions with the support of your team.
  • Using data to make informed decisions and business directives.
  • Lead the design and delivery of learning programs that build capability and support career growth.
  • Champion and ensure the businesses academy and apprenticeship programme and scheme are world class and fit for purpose.
  • Champion leadership development, coaching, and succession planning.
  • Embed a culture of continuous learning and feedback.
  • Oversee performance management frameworks that drive accountability and growth.
  • Lead employee engagement initiatives and culture-building programs.
  • Promote diversity, equity, and inclusion across all talent practices.
  • Build and lead a high-performing Talent team.
  • Serve as a trusted advisor to the executive team on all talent-related matters.

More about you:

  • Proven success in high-growth, fast-paced environments—ideally PE-backed/ mission-driven.
  • Deep expertise across talent acquisition, with further experience in L&D, performance, and engagement.
  • Strategic thinker with strong execution skills and a data-driven mindset.
  • Passionate about education and building high-impact teams.
